Solr-6.6 Cloudにおけるtlogのサイズ管理

トピック作成者:ks-solruserml-bot (2024/05/23 12:55 投稿)
3
CloseClose

(The bot translated the original post https://lists.apache.org/thread/43x7f9rgx2yp8t7jb9sx6djgsr9zf0nv into Japanese and reposted it under Apache License 2.0. The copyright of posted content is held by the original poster.)

こんにちは

各シャードのレプリカでtlogサイズが実際のインデックスサイズ約40GBに対して約150GBに増加するという問題に直面しています。

ハードコミットも有効にしており、データのインデックス作成時に*commit=true*も渡していますが、効果がありません。

この件について助けていただけますか?

返信投稿者:ks-solruserml-bot (2024/05/23 12:55 投稿)

こんにちは,

システムと設定からの詳細情報がないと、問題の原因を推測することは不可能です。しかし、一般的には、私が使用している SolrCloud 6.6 にはそのような問題はありません。私のクラウドは、5つのシャードと各々の2つのレプリカを5つのノードに持ち、合計260百万のレコードを持っています。各々1〜3つのtlogファイルがあり、サイズは最大50MBまでです。

Bernd

返信投稿者:ks-solruserml-bot (2024/05/23 12:56 投稿)

Hi Brend,

返信ありがとう。

私が受け取っているエラーは次の通りです。

INFO - 2021-03-23 19:45:32.433; [c:solrcollection s:shard2 r:core_node4 x:solrcollection_shard2_replica2]
org.apache.solr.update.processor.DistributedUpdateProcessor; Ignoring commit while not ACTIVE - state: APPLYING_BUFFERED replay: false
INFO - 2021-03-23 19:45:32.444; [c:solrcollection s:shard2 r:core_node4 x:solrcollection_shard2_replica2]
org.apache.solr.update.processor.DistributedUpdateProcessor; Ignoring commit while not ACTIVE - state: APPLYING_BUFFERED replay: false
INFO - 2021-03-23 19:45:32.874; [c:solrcollection s:shard2 r:core_node4 x:solrcollection_shard2_replica2]
org.apache.solr.update.processor.DistributedUpdateProcessor; Ignoring commit while not ACTIVE - state: APPLYING_BUFFERED replay: false
INFO - 2021-03-23 19:45:33.031; [c:solrcollection s:shard2 r:core_node4 x:solrcollection_shard2_replica2]
org.apache.solr.update.processor.DistributedUpdateProcessor; Ignoring commit while not ACTIVE - state: APPLYING_BUFFERED replay: false
INFO - 2021-03-23 19:45:33.331; [c:solrcollection s:shard2 r:core_node4 x:solrcollection_shard2_replica2]
org.apache.solr.update.processor.DistributedUpdateProcessor; Ignoring commit while not ACTIVE - state: APPLYING_BUFFERED replay: false
返信投稿者:ks-solruserml-bot (2024/05/23 12:57 投稿)

Ritvikさん,
見たところ、インデックスを作成している際にレプリカがリカバリ中であり、レプリカが tlog をリプレイする速度よりもインデックス作成が速くなっているため、レプリカが追いつけないようです。私たちの本番 Solr クラスター(これも 6.6 です)でもこれが何度も発生しました。このような場合、Solr が tlog のすべての更新を追いつくように、インデックス作業量を制限する必要があります。
Brian

トピックへ返信するには、ログインが必要です。

KandaSearch

Copyright © 2006-2025 RONDHUIT Co, Ltd. All Rights Reserved.

投稿の削除

この投稿を削除します。よろしいですか?